# Break-Glass: Catalog Cache Invalidation

Scope: the Pinrow product catalog at Veldstone Retail. If stale prices persist after a purge and the Hollowmere invalidation queue is wedged, use break-glass to flush the edge tier directly. Contractors: get verbal sign-off from the catalog lead first. Steps: open the Hollowmere admin shell, select emergency-flush, confirm the tenant, and run it once — repeated flushes thrash the origin. Access is logged and expires after 20 minutes. Unseal the admin shell with the passphrase below.

recovery phrase for kahop-tajog: istix-casvan

# Settings for Corvid plugin adapters.
# The legacy Hobstack job queue is deprecated; all plugins
# must target the new Corvid broker as of this release.
# Do not write to the old queue tables — they are read-only.
# Configure the broker's backing database with the
# connection string below.

primary connection of tawif-yajeg = postgresql://rusiel_svc:G879q9cx6GsSvj@db-dd9f.norvagrid.internal:5432/casath

### FAQ: How do I compress telemetry payloads for Signalwick?

Use the bundled codec, not your own. Signalwick accepts zstd frames up to 2 MB; anything larger is rejected at the edge. Declare the compression flag in your plugin manifest or the collector treats payloads as raw. Batching is preferred over per-event frames.

If your plugin needs to read the staging decompression sandbox for debugging, access is gated. Request a sandbox session from the plugin portal; the session unlock prompt expects the recovery passphrase below.

unlock words, hahip-baduf: holwyn-istath-julvan